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• 4 years of experience in product management, digital marketing, management consulting, or project management within technology.
  • Experience in working with product management or engineering teams, executive leadership, and other c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Experience in managing end-to-end projects or business initiatives from initial analysis through to execution, with experience in developing business strategies and managing cross-functional initiatives.

Preferred qualifications:

  • Experience in partnering with clients on technical products (e.g., pitching solutions, consulting, project management, implementation, demonstrating products, or technical business).
  • Experience with using data and market intelligence to identify trends, solve problems, and provide recommendations including building quantitative models and performing data analysis (e.g., using spreadsheets, SQL, or dashboards).
  • Ability to structure a storyline and build presentation decks or documents to support the position.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Excellent thinking and problem solving skills, with the ability to lead operational initiatives.

About the job

The Go-to-Market Operations (GTM) team ensures Google's and ever-evolving Ads business runs smoothly. We are instrumental in setting go-to-market strategy, and ensuring execution and operations against the strategy. We have teams embedded in each of the major Ads business areas and global teams that work across the business areas.

The Global Product Solutions team is the link between Google products and business.

In this role, you will help to turn product innovation into complete, packaged use cases and solutions that allow the customers to get the most that they need from the suite of products. You will help to ensure that Google has adopted the right strategy for the products. You will use the expertise to help front-line business partners. You will be driving customer success through innovation and help shape the changing world of online advertising.The US base salary range for this full-time position is $125,000-$179,000 + bonus + equity + benefits. Responsibilities

  • Support the development and GTM execution of global plans for new product features, including defining success metrics and tracking adoption. Synthesize feedback from business teams and advertisers to help influence the product development feedback loop and technical requirements.
  • Conduct analysis of market intelligence, market shifts, and participants products to provide insights for the product area.
  • Translate technical capabilities into business enablement materials, narratives, and market-facing stories.
  • Partner with Product, Marketing, and Business teams to ensure stakeholder coordination and alignment on priorities and project milestones.
  • Help to define success metrics and perform performance tracking of product adoption and business impact for leadership review.
